All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gwarchives.net/va/vafiles.htm ************************************************ RUBY ANNA HOLMES ALLEN BRANCH SURRY - Ruby Anna Holmes Allen-Branch, 87, passed away peacefully in her sleep on Friday, Sept. 29, 2006, at the home of her daughter in Reigalwood, N.C. She was born in Feb. 14, 1919 in Dendron, Va., to the late Lizzie Bagley Holmes-Walker and Jacob Holmes. She joined St. Paul Holiness Church at an early age and attended when she could also attending Mount Nebo Baptist Church. She was preceded in death by her first husband, James Allen, Jr., her second husband, Percell Branch, Sr., her son, Percell Branch, Jr., son-in-law, Jimmy Parrish, and grandson, Keith Murphy Jr. She leaves to cherish her memories, her children, Thomas Allen (Dorothy) of Bethlehem, Pa., Juliet Elizabeth Allen Parrish of Plainfield, N.J., Ruby Allen Daniels of Reigalwood, N.J., Henrietta B. Tullis of Surry, Va., Dorothy Branch and Laura Branch of Plainfield, N.J., James Branch, Benjamin Branch (Virginia) and Joseph Lewis Branch all of Surry, Va.; two daughters-in-law, Virginia White of Martenburg, W.Va.; 21 grandchildren, 30 great-grandchildren, a host of nieces, nephews, cousins, other relatives and friends. Funeral services will be held 1 p.m. Friday, Oct. 6, 2006, at St. Paul Holiness Church with Pastor Earnest Greene, officiating. Interment will be in the Branch Family Cemetery. Viewing from 6 to 8 p.m. Thursday at Poole’s Funeral Home and one hour prior to the service Friday at the church. Arrangements by Poole’s Funeral Home, Sabrina Hardt- Newby Funeral Directress 757-357-4742. Ruby Anna (HOLMES ALLEN; Mrs. Percell A. Sr.) BRANCH, b. 14 Feb 1919, Dendron*, d. 29 Sep 2006, at daughter's home, Reigalwood, NJ, interred in the BRANCH family cemetery, California Xrds., Surry Co., 6 Oct 2006, "The Daily Press (Newport News, VA), Oct. 4, 2006 *Additional information: Find a Grave Mem. #129848500 The record of her first marriage gives b. Sussex Co. (Surry Co. M.Cert. 1940-3315) James C. ALLEN (1917-1945) was removed from Princess Anne Co. to Bacon's Castle.
